Postgraduate Course: Quality Management in Wildlife Forensic Science (VESC11179)

Course Outline
SchoolRoyal (Dick) School of Veterinary Studies CollegeCollege of Medicine and Veterinary Medicine
Credit level (Normal year taken)SCQF Level 11 (Postgraduate)
Course typeOnline Distance Learning AvailabilityAvailable to all students
SCQF Credits10 ECTS Credits5
SummaryExplains the processes of quality assurance essential fir the production and delivery of wildlife forensic evidence.
Course description -Chain of Custody
-QA
-Validation
-Quality Management Systems
-Standard Operating Procedures
-Forms
-Case File Management

Learning Outcomes
On completion of this course, the student will be able to:
  1. Demonstrate a critical understanding of the essential processes involved in evidential security and quality assurance.
  2. Able to design a professional validation plan for a specified forensic laboratory method.
